Traditionally, realtors were viewed primarily as sales agents tasked with facilitating property transactions․ However, the role of realtors has significantly expanded in response to changing consumer expectations and technological advancements․ Today’s real estate professionals are expected to be more than just intermediaries; they are viewed as trusted advisors who provide valuable insights and guidance throughout the buying or selling process․
As the real estate market continues to evolve, certain trends are emerging that reflect changing consumer preferences․ Understanding these trends can help realtors adapt their strategies to meet the needs of their clients effectively․
The COVID-19 pandemic accelerated the adoption of virtual tools in real estate․ Consumers now expect realtors to offer virtual tours, online consultations, and digital documentation processes․ This trend is likely to persist, as many buyers appreciate the convenience of exploring properties from the comfort of their homes․
Modern consumers are increasingly concerned about environmental issues․ Many buyers are looking for properties that prioritize sustainability, such as energy-efficient features, eco-friendly materials, and green certifications․ Realtors who can highlight these attributes will find greater appeal among environmentally conscious clients․
Consumers are not just purchasing a property; they are investing in a lifestyle․ Realtors who can provide insights into local amenities, schools, parks, and community events will resonate more with buyers seeking a sense of belonging and community connection․
Word-of-mouth referrals and online reviews play a significant role in shaping consumer choices․ Clients are more likely to choose realtors with positive testimonials and a strong online presence․ Establishing credibility through social proof is essential for attracting new clients․
Today’s consumers are more informed than ever, thanks to the wealth of information available online․ They seek realtors who can educate them about the buying or selling process, market conditions, and financing options․ Providing valuable resources and insights empowers clients to make confident decisions․
To meet the evolving expectations of consumers, realtors must focus on building lasting relationships․ This involves not only meeting immediate needs but also nurturing connections that extend beyond individual transactions․ Here are key strategies for fostering strong relationships:
Regular communication is vital in maintaining client relationships․ Realtors should keep clients informed about market trends, new listings, and relevant updates even after a transaction is complete․ This ongoing engagement helps build trust and loyalty․
Realtors can enhance their value by offering resources that go beyond the immediate transaction․ This could include home maintenance tips, market updates, or connections to reputable service providers in the community․ By positioning themselves as valuable resources, realtors can deepen their relationships with clients․
Small gestures can make a significant impact on client relationships․ Sending personalized notes, celebrating milestones, or following up after closing can create a lasting impression and foster goodwill․ These efforts demonstrate that realtors genuinely care about their clients’ well-being․
